My current setup is no slouch. I'm running a rig that comfortably exceeds the game's recommended specifications, with the sole exception of the CPU being just a hair under. Booting up the game on the "High" visual preset, I was greeted with a generally solid 60fps out in the open world. It felt great, exactly as promised. But that stability is a fleeting illusion. The moment any real action starts or, more tellingly, when I wander into a village, the numbers start to tumble. We're talking dips into the 40s, and inside the bustling cities, it can drop even lower, sometimes into the high 20s. Now, is it playable? Technically, yes. It's not a complete slideshow, but it's far from the fluid, responsive experience you expect from a modern AAA title. It feels unstable, like walking on a floor that you know might give way at any moment.

Here’s the real kicker, the part that points to a deeper issue: this performance is bizarrely consistent across all visual settings. This is the most noticeable misstep. Out of sheer frustration, I tried dropping everything to "Low." I turned off shadows, dialed back textures, and slaughtered every visual flourish I could find. The result? A negligible performance bump, maybe a frame or two. My rig, capable of rendering far more complex scenes in other titles, was being held back. It became clear this isn't a demand issue; it's an optimization issue. The game simply isn't leveraging the hardware properly. I could've used the performance bump from lowering shadow quality and the like, but doing so has no effect. It’s as if the game has a fixed performance tax for certain areas, regardless of how pretty you want it to look. This isn't a matter of needing a better graphics card; it's a matter of the game needing a better conversation with the hardware it's running on.

I’ve spoken with a few tech-savvy friends who are facing the same wall, and the consensus is unanimous: this is a CPU-bound scenario. The game's engine is seemingly struggling to manage the complex AI routines, physics, and background logic for dozens of characters simultaneously. One friend, who works in software development, put it bluntly: "It's like the game is trying to calculate the life story of every single peasant in the city at once, and it's bringing even powerful processors to their knees." This expert, albeit informal, comment rings true. It explains why reducing GPU-loading settings like shadows and textures does almost nothing—the bottleneck is elsewhere. The core computation is the problem.
